Full Text

A large quantity of goods, consisting of beds, bedding, and female apparel, which was stolen a short time since, from R. Steiner, was found yesterday by officer Driesback. It appears they were stolen by one Wm. Allen, an old offender, who sold a part of them to Edwin Foley, in whose possession they were found.

Allen stated to Foley that his wife was dead, and that he wanted to sell out for the purpose of going South, and finally persuaded Foley to take a part. Allen was committed and Foley discharged.
